A day in the life.......

"At the start of the shift, you will be issued with the plan for your line. You need to be diligent and accurate as you prepare the line. This involves completing Health & Safety and compliance paperwork, ordering fruits and packing materials, and ensuring that all machines and the checkweigher are functioning correctly. The main objective is to pack high-quality fruits safely and efficiently, meeting our targets and ensuring customer satisfaction with every product. However, their responsibilities go beyond just running the line. You need to understand the specifications and know what the customers expect. You will ensure that everything is done correctly and that your team always performs at their best."
